In 2015, The Stars Group implemented Infor SunSystems. The deployment targeted the companys core finance organization under the ERP Financial category, aligning corporate and regional accounting teams on a single financial ledger and reporting platform.
The Infor SunSystems implementation centered on standard ERP Financial capabilities, including general ledger configuration, accounts payable processing, accounts receivable management, fixed asset accounting, and period close orchestration. Configuration work emphasized a multi-entity chart of accounts, transaction posting rules, and native reporting and query facilities provided by Infor SunSystems to support statutory and management reporting.
Operational coverage focused on finance, tax, and accounting functions across the companys corporate finance group and regional accounting teams. Implementation patterns reflect extensive use of SunSystems query and analysis capabilities, with finance users extracting data into Excel for ad hoc analysis and reconciliations, consistent with hiring notes that list previous working knowledge of the SUN accounting system and Excel-based query and analysis reporting as desirable.
Governance and process changes accompanied the rollout, with role-based access and period close workflows instituted to standardize month-end procedures and financial control. Staffing and skills requirements were adjusted to emphasize SunSystems functional expertise and Excel-based data handling for reporting and analysis, supporting operational handoffs between accounting, consolidation, and finance reporting teams.

In 2021, The Stars Group implemented OneTrust Cookie Consent. The deployment is focused on the company website and customer-facing web properties, addressing cookie lifecycle and consent capture within the Governance, Risk and Compliance category. The implementation centralizes consent capture at the browser layer through a consent banner and a preference center, enabling granular user choices across cookie categories. OneTrust Cookie Consent is configured to present consent options and to persist consent state for auditability and compliance recordkeeping.
Configuration emphasizes cookie categorization, consent logging, and automated blocking of nonessential scripts until consent is obtained, reflecting standard cookie management workflows. Operational ownership spans privacy, legal, marketing, and web operations teams, with the OneTrust Cookie Consent deployment feeding consent records into internal compliance processes. Integrations are implemented at the public website layer, with cookie controls and preference management enforced on page load and during session activity. Governance changes include formalizing user preference capture and recordkeeping to support cross functional compliance workflows.
